Answer:

The answer to your question is height = 9.20 m

Step-by-step explanation:

Data

Work = 587 kJ

mass of the body = 6500 kg

height = ?

Mechanic work is defined as the force applied to a body times its mass.

Process

1.- Calculate the weight of the body

weight = mass x gravity (9.81)

weight = 6500 x 9.81

= 63765 N

2.- Calculate the height

height = work / weight

-Substitution

height = 587 000 / 63765

-Result

height = 9.20 m
